Markets Climb Over Hopes for Biden Administration, New Stimulus
It was a fairly quiet session for the TSX on Monday as U.S. markets were closed for the Martin Luther King Jr. holiday. While most TSX sectors were up, energy stocks closed down more than 1.5 per cent. By Monday’s close, however, the index finished with a mild 36-point gain.
It was a strong day for U.S. equities on Tuesday, as markets headed higher over incoming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en’s endorsement for aggressive coronavirus relief spending. By Tuesday’s close, the Dow was up 116 points, while the S&P and Nasdaq added 31 and 199, respectively. In Canada, the TSX added just 12 points, despite a rallying energy sector.
